Small Business Person of the Year

The U.S. Small Business Administration (SBA) has named Denise S. Navarro, President and CEO of Logical Innovations, (LI2) ("LI squared")the 2016 District Small Business Person of the Year.  The company specializes in Program / Project Management Support Services; Information Technology Support Services; Training Design, Development, and Delivery; Performance Improvement; Customer Service; Conference / Meeting / Outreach Services; Documentation, Data and Configuration Management; Administrative Services and Logistics Management.“

 

Other Regional and/or district winners.  

* Entrepreneurial Success Award Winner of the Year – Timothy B. Murphy of Gold’s Gym.  After owning and operating several clubs, Bryan Murphy joined Gold's Gym International, as General Manager over 9 locations in Austin, TX. Recently, he started his first Gold's Gym franchise.

 

 

  * Veteran Small Business Champion of the Year – Robert J. Warren of University of Houston Procurement Technical Assistance Center (UH PTAC), served with the US Air Force and Air Force Reserve for 26 years. As a Reservist called up during Desert Shield / Desert Storm he saw veteran business owners lose their businesses to the demands of their Reserve duty. When Bob joined the University of Houston Procurement Technical Assistance Center (UH PTAC) in 2009 he brought those experiences with him into the new job. 

  * Financial Services Champion of the Year – Marlon Mitchell, President and CEO of Houston Business Development, Inc. (HBDi), a non-profit 501(c)(3) corporation, established in 1986, serves as a catalyst in stimulating economic growth and revitalizing communities throughout the city of Houston, Texas. Empowering small businesses to grow and create jobs, which in turn will help build strong neighborhoods and communities, is our primary objective. 

 

Family-Owned Small Business of the Year – Raj Shafaii, Shafaii Party and Reception Center

 

 

 Women in Business Champion of the Year– Helen Callier, President, Bradlink, LLC, one of North America's most recognized Technical Services Firm providing Program Management, Facilities Design, BIM, and Operations/Maintenance services to government agency and Fortune 500 private project owners. Some of Bradlink’s clients include the Houston Airport System, AECOM, TDIndustries, JACOBS, XEROX, and CH2MHill. Bradlink is 100% woman, minority, small business certified and is certified by Small Business Administration as an 8(a). Helen is an alumni of Goldman Sachs 10KSB Program.
